New England Garage Rock outfit Salem Wolves have skipped to the good part and released Greatest Hits, Vol. 2, a five-track collection that reimagines songs by Jawbreaker, The Replacements, Hüsker Dü, INXS and Tom Waits through the band’s gritty, surf-bitten lens. The EP is now available digitally on all platforms, with a Bandcamp first release in time for Bandcamp Friday. Where’s Volume 1, you ask? Better not to.
“Coming off our last record we were just looking to do something fun and not so conceptual. We’ve historically been opposed to learning covers, mainly because we’re lazy and only know so many chords. But this was a chance to play the songs we grew up loving, the secret architecture of our taste and style.” (vocalist & guitarist Gray Bouchard)
